A routine email message keeps reappearing in a mail folder, a subfolder of the Inbox. IMAP account with Xfinity. Office 365, Windows 10 Pro

This message is from a friend with two attachments (photos) plus a link to flickr. I have deleted this message at least four times now but it keeps coming back many times each time it reappears. It definitely sounds like you’ve got your very own version of The Sorcerer’s Apprentice — only instead of a multiplying broom, it’s a ghost email that won’t quit!
Since you're using an IMAP account with Xfinity, the issue is probably on the server-side sync. When you delete the email in Outlook, it tells the Xfinity server to delete it — but if that server doesn’t register the deletion properly, Outlook will re-download the message as if it’s new.

What you can try:​


  1. Log in via Xfinity Webmail and delete the message there. If it’s removed directly from the server, Outlook won’t keep seeing it.
  2. Purge deleted messages (in Outlook: Folder > Purge > Purge Marked Items in "All Accounts")
  3. If it keeps returning, delete and recreate the IMAP account profile — it’s tedious but often solves persistent sync loops.
  4. Run ScanPST or rebuild the .ost file just to ensure it’s not a local caching issue.
